Church of England debate over Muslim conversion

http://www.evangelicals.org/news.asp?id=873

[EV News] 27 May 2008--The BBC News website reports that Paul Eddy, a lay member of General Synod will continue with a campaign for the Church of England to try to evangelise Muslims, despite coming under intense pressure from bishops to withdraw the plan.

The motion calls on the Church to proclaim Christianity as the only route to ultimate salvation. He said he had received angry e-mails and telephone calls from senior figures in the Church denouncing his motion. However, Mr Eddy has secured enough support for his motion to be debated at the next meeting of Synod in July.

Mr Eddy claims to have the backing of at least 124 members of the synod, including the Bishops of Rochester, Carlisle and Chester.
